SUBJECT: Frew Street Summer Utility Improvement Project
Frew Street will be undergoing a utility improvement project which will impact the vehicular and pedestrian traffic this summer. The first phase of this project will be located adjacent to Porter Hall and Baker-Porter Hall. Underground utilities in this area will be installed under the campus sidewalk in 3 sub-phases. See the attached traffic control plan which outlines anticipated sub-phases.
As a part of this project, Frew Street will be reconfigured for one-way traffic with parallel parking to conform with the recently approved Institutional Master Plan. On May 15th and 16th Frew Street will be closed to all public traffic and parking. The street will be reopened on May 17th with one-way traffic running from Tech Street to Shenley Drive.
A temporary walkway on the park side of Frew Street will be installed with crosswalks while the campus sidewalk is removed for construction from May 17th through August 18th. The ADA parking outside of Baker-Porter Hall will be temporarily relocated during the summer.
At the end of the summer the campus sidewalk will be re-opened to pedestrian traffic, ADA parking will be restored, and Frew Street will remain as a one-way road with parallel parking. Phase 2 will take place summer 2024 between Baker Hall and Posner Hall.
